Virtual Reconstruction of Vehicle Crash Accident Based on Elastic-Plastic Deformation of Auto-Body

Abstract: The finite element method, which has been widely used in crashworthiness analyses and structural optimization design, is not practical in the traffic accident reconstruction because of the limitation of computation ability. Elastic-plastic deformation of the vehicle and the collision object are the important information produced during the course of the traffic accidents, and the information can be fully utilized by using the finite element method to increase the computing precision.
